May is Mental Health Awareness Month, and mental health is a feminist issue.

Women and girls experience higher rates of depression and anxiety, yet many still face barriers to accessing care. Gender-based violence, economic inequality, and caregiving responsibilities all shape mental well-being.

Mental health care should be accessible, affordable, and stigma-free for everyone.

This month, we recognize the importance of mental health, support those who are struggling, and advocate for systems that prioritize well-being.

May is Asian American and Pacific Islander Heritage Month! It’s a time to celebrate the cultures, contributions, and leadership of AAPI communities across the United States.

While AAPI communities have some of the highest rates of college education in the country, millions still face poverty, discrimination, and barriers to opportunity. Recognizing both progress and ongoing challenges is key to building a more equitable future.

This month, celebrate AAPI voices, learn the history, and stand against anti-Asian racism.
